Find an invertible matrix $P$ and a diagonal matrix $D$ so that $A=PDP^{−1}$. Use your answer to find an expression for A$^6$ in terms of $P$, a power of $D$, and $P−1$ in that order.

Find the eigenvalues and eigenvectors. Eigenvalues will give you the matrix D, vectors P. Then the rest should come easy. Good luck on your test...
